如何制作VPS?从零开始搭建VPS服务器的全过程
卡尔云官网
www.kaeryun.com
在当今数字时代,虚拟专用服务器(VPS)已经成为企业级服务器的常见选择,如果你也想体验一下VPS的魅力,或者为你的业务提供一个稳定的云服务环境,那么本文将 guides you step by step on how to create your own VPS server.
准备工作
选择合适的虚拟机平台
你需要选择一个可靠的虚拟机平台,常见的有:
- AWS(亚马逊云服务)
- DigitalOcean
- HostGator
- GoDaddy
- Cloudflare
这些平台提供了各种虚拟机服务,适合不同预算和需求的用户。
确定操作系统
VPS服务器通常运行Linux操作系统,尤其是Debian或Ubuntu,这些操作系统稳定性好,且有丰富的软件资源。
安装操作系统
下载Linux镜像
根据你的平台选择对应的Linux镜像,如果你选择的是AWS,可以下载AWS代用镜像。
安装系统
安装过程中,确保启用网络连接,以便自动连接到互联网。
启用防火墙
安装完成后,启用防火墙,以允许VPS与其他设备之间的通信。
配置VPS服务器
设置服务器时间
VPS需要一个时钟同步服务,如NTP,以确保时间的准确性。
配置邮件服务
大多数VPS平台提供集成的邮件服务,如Postfix或SMTP。
配置数据库
安装一个常见的数据库,如MySQL或PostgreSQL,以支持应用程序的存储需求。
安全配置
安装防火墙
安装入侵检测系统(IDS)如UFW,以保护服务器免受恶意攻击。
设置安全提示
定期检查VPS的配置,确保没有未更新的软件或配置漏洞。
监控与维护
数据备份
定期备份重要数据,以防万一。
服务器监控
使用工具如Nagios或Zabbix来监控服务器状态。
处理常见问题
如果遇到服务中断,及时检查配置并联系平台客服。
部署应用程序
安装应用软件
根据需要安装PHP、Python或其他语言的开发环境。
配置服务器配置
配置服务器配置文件,如Apache配置,以支持应用程序的运行。
测试应用
在VPS上进行测试,确保应用能够正常运行。
托管与扩展
托管到云服务提供商
将VPS托管到云服务提供商,如AWS、Google Cloud等,以享受更多的资源。
扩展资源
根据需求,增加虚拟机的资源,如内存、存储等。
制作VPS服务器虽然需要一定的技术背景,但通过以上步骤,你可以逐步搭建出一个功能齐全的VPS服务器,配置和维护是最关键的部分,只有正确配置,才能确保VPS的稳定运行,希望本文能帮助你顺利搭建自己的VPS服务器,为企业或个人提供一个可靠的云服务环境。
卡尔云官网
www.kaeryun.com